Immanuel & St Andrew, Streatham

Immanuel and St Andrew's (usually just called "Immanuel") serves a diverse parish in an urban priority area. The congregation is drawn from a wide variety of walks of life. Ethnic minorities, particularly from African and Caribbean countries, are well represented. It is a church where many have found a welcome, including those who have had little contact with the church prior to coming to Immanuel.

Holy Communion (with groups for children and young people).
The service normally follows Common Worship Order One but with a break between the intercessions and the peace for meditation or discussion, and for refreshments. Young people leave for their own groups shortly after the start of the service and rejoin at the break. For more information see the parish website.
